| General description: | Cytiva′s high-purity quartz microfiber filters are used in many air sampling filter applications, including sampling of acidic gases, stacks, flues, and aerosols. Filters are suitable for PM-10 sampling and analysis. Because of the low level of alkaline earth metals, "artifact" products of sulfates and nitrates (from SO₂ and NO₂) are virtually eliminated. High-purity quartz microfiber filters are therefore applicable for particulate monitoring and heavy metal analysis. QM-A quartz microfiber filters from Cytiva come in a wide range of circle diameters, as well as 25-piece sheets. QM-A sheets (1851-8866) are sequentially numbered according to U.S.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) standards and are suitable for most applications.• Grade: QM-A • Description: Quartz • Particle Retention in Liquid (μm): 2.2 • Air Flow (s/100 mL/in²): 6.4 • Typical Thickness (μm): 450 • Basis Weight (g/m²): 85 |
